Waterberg Safari, Entabeni Game Reserve | South Africa | North-West and Limpopo

Enjoy a two night safari at Entabeni Game Reserve in the pristine malaria-free Waterberg - a stunning area of natural beauty where a dramatic plateau with panoramic views is dissected by ravines and waterfalls. This Big 5 safari can be easily added to many other tours and the number of nights can be increased as required. This tour is based on Lakeside Lodge but you can upgrade to the more luxurious Earthsong or Kingfisher Lodges or have a more rustic experience at the charming Wildside Camp.

Climate Temperate climate - hot summers with afternoon rains, warm dry and sunny winters with cold nights
Best time to go Suitable all year round, especially April to December
Health Requirements Non-malaria area. Sunblock essential.

Day 1 : Depart Johannesburg for 2 nights Entabeni Game Reserve, Waterberg, Full board and Game drives
Today you are transferred from the Johannesburg Airport to Lakeside Lodge in the Entabeni Game Reserve in the Waterberg region. This beautiful reserve has a varied terrain supporting a wide range of general game and the Big Five. The uplands are open grasslands with wooded hillsides. The lower part of the reserve is bushveld and accessed by a very dramatic ravine. Lakeside Lodge enjoys a stunning setting overlooking the lake. On arrival you settle into your room and then take afternoon tea before setting off on your game drive. As the sun sets, the afternoon drive becomes a night safari following nocturnal animals as they begin to hunt. The evening meal is often enjoyed in a ?boma? or even in the bush around an open fire, which many guests feel is a particularly evocative treat.

Day 2 : On safari at Entabeni
Activities at Entabeni include twice-daily game drives in open game 4x4 vehicles, guided nature walks, horse riding, picnic lunches and bush sundowners. A visit to the Pedi cultural village can also be arranged. Take an early morning game drive, as the animals rise early to hunt in the cool of the day. The two to three hour drive finishes in time for a late breakfast, which will be keenly appreciated after your early morning start! The middle part of the day is generally spent relaxing by the pool, or catching up on your sleep. A late afternoon game drive will introduce you to some of the nocturnal animals and their predators before enjoying at atmospheric dinner back at the lodge.

Day 3 : Return to Johannesburg
After a final morning game drive followed by breakfast, you are transferred back to the Johannesburg Airport by road for your onwards travel arrangements.
